English: The Sint-Pieters- en Pauluskerk (Saint peter's and Paul's Church) is a former Jesuit Church in Mechelen. The pulpit was sculpted by Hendrik Frans Verbruggen (April 30, 1654 in Antwerp – December 12, 1724, Antwerp).
The allegorical figure for Africa. The pulpit rests on a globe carried by land animals; allegories for the four known continents are sitting on the globe:
